- head cauliflower; chopped into bite size piece
- ½ cup flour
- ½ cup water
- Pinch of kosher salt
- Pinch of granulated garlic powder
- Non-stick olive oil spray
For Wing Sauce:
- 1 Tbs. Earth Balance butter substitute; melted
- 2/3 cup Sriracha
- 2 Tbs your choice of Hot sauce (I used Buffalo Style Tabasco)
Preheat oven to 400F.
In a small bowl, Whisk together flour, water, garlic powder and salt.
Dip cauliflower pieces in the batter ensuring pieces are coating evenly, place on a lightly greased, non-stick baking sheet.
Bake “wings” for about 10 minutes, then flip with a spatula and bake on the other side for an additional 5 minutes.
Whisk together Frank’s Red Hot sauce and Earth Balance butter substitute in a small bowl.
Remove wings from oven, and using a bbq brush, coast each piece with the hot sauce mixture
Bake coated cauliflower for an additional 10 minutes with hot sauce Remove from oven.
Let cauliflower wings cool a bit before devouring
